First, choose the right ski resort. Queenstown is home to several world-class ski areas, including The Remarkables, Coronet Peak, and Ben Lomond. Each offers a unique experience, from family-friendly slopes to challenging terrain for experts. The Remarkables is a popular choice for its diverse runs and stunning views, while Coronet Peak is known for its well-groomed pistes and excellent snow conditions. Research the resorts based on your skill level and preferences to ensure you get the most out of your visit.

Next, invest in the right gear. While many ski resorts in Queenstown offer rental equipment, it’s always better to bring your own if possible. Properly fitted skis, boots, and poles are essential for safety and performance. Don’t forget to wear warm, waterproof clothing and goggles to protect against the cold and wind. If you’re new to skiing, consider taking a lesson to learn the basics and build confidence on the slopes.

Before heading to the mountain, check the weather and snow conditions. Queenstown’s ski season typically runs from June to October, but conditions can vary depending on the year. Use reliable weather apps or the resort’s website to get up-to-date information on snowfall, temperatures, and trail conditions. This will help you plan your days and avoid unexpected delays or cancellations.

For a unique twist, try heli-skiing or backcountry skiing. These options allow you to explore untouched powder and remote terrain, but they require more experience and preparation. Make sure to hire a qualified guide and follow all safety protocols to ensure a safe and enjoyable adventure.
